>> There're two cases of outgoing call: dial from HF or dial from phone.
>>
>> In the first case, some phones may not support enhanced call status
>> (AT+CLCC) to query outgoing number. So we need to pass struct
>> atd_cb_data to fill in the number and type. Later, we invoke
>> AT+CLCC to query phone number and overwrite ours if we are wrong.
>
> This is actually not necessary. The core already tracks the
> outgoing number and fills it in if the dial returns before the
> new call is notified. This should be always the case in HFP,
> since the ATD returns before CIEV is signaled, correct?
The reason to record outgoing number is for later clcc_poll_cb in multicall
hanlding, because HFP doesn't have COLP so it don't know the outgoing
number unless we do +CLCC poll. So we need to sync it.
